description Abstract Strings on AdS 3 × S 3 × T 4 with mixed Ramond-Ramond and Neveu-Schwarz-Neveu-Schwarz flux are known to be classically integrable. This is a crucial property of this model, which cannot be studied by conventional worldsheet-CFT techniques. Integrability should carry over to the quantum level, and the worldsheet S matrix in the lightcone gauge is known up to the so-called dressing factors. In this work we study the kinematics of mixed-flux theories and consider a relativistic limit of the S matrix whereby we can complete the bootstrap program, including the dressing factors for fundamental particles and bound states. This provides an important test for the dressing factors of the full worldsheet model, and offers new insights on the features of the model when the amount of NSNS flux is low.
